DataSet.Namespace プロパティ

定義

DataSet の名前空間を取得または設定します。Gets or sets the namespace of the DataSet.

public:
 property System::String ^ Namespace { System::String ^ get(); void set(System::String ^ value); };
public string Namespace { get; set; }
[System.Data.DataSysDescription("DataSetNamespaceDescr")]
public string Namespace { get; set; }
member this.Namespace : string with get, set
[<System.Data.DataSysDescription("DataSetNamespaceDescr")>]
member this.Namespace : string with get, set
Public Property Namespace As String

プロパティ値

String

DataSet の名前空間。The namespace of the DataSet.

属性

例外

この名前空間には既にデータが格納されています。The namespace already has data.

次の例では、 Prefix メソッドを呼び出す前にを設定し ReadXml ます。The following example sets the Prefix before calling the ReadXml method.

private void ReadData(DataSet thisDataSet)
{
    thisDataSet.Namespace = "CorporationA";
    thisDataSet.Prefix = "DivisionA";

    // Read schema and data.
    string fileName = "CorporationA_Schema.xml";
    thisDataSet.ReadXmlSchema(fileName);
    fileName = "DivisionA_Report.xml";
    thisDataSet.ReadXml(fileName);
}
Private Sub ReadData(thisDataSet As DataSet)
    thisDataSet.Namespace = "CorporationA"
    thisDataSet.Prefix = "DivisionA"

    ' Read schema and data.
    Dim fileName As String = "CorporationA_Schema.xml"
    thisDataSet.ReadXmlSchema(fileName)
    fileName = "DivisionA_Report.xml"
    thisDataSet.ReadXml(fileName)
End Sub

注釈

プロパティは、、、 Namespace DataSet 、またはの各メソッドを使用して、XML ドキュメントの読み取りと書き込みを行うときに使用され ReadXml WriteXml ReadXmlSchema WriteXmlSchema ます。The Namespace property is used when reading and writing an XML document into the DataSet using the ReadXml, WriteXml, ReadXmlSchema, or WriteXmlSchema methods.

XML ドキュメントの名前空間は、に読み取るときに XML の属性と要素のスコープを限定するために使用され DataSet ます。The namespace of an XML document is used to scope XML attributes and elements when read into a DataSet. たとえば、に、 DataSet 名前空間が "myCompany" のドキュメントから読み取られたスキーマが含まれていて、別の名前空間を持つドキュメントからのみデータの読み取りを試みた場合、既存のスキーマに対応していないデータは無視されます。For example, if a DataSet contains a schema that was read from a document with the namespace "myCompany," and an attempt is made to read data only from a document with a different namespace, any data that does not correspond to the existing schema is ignored.

適用対象

こちらもご覧ください